——犀牛教育“5周年”课程大促——
计算机发烧友注意!想冲击藤校、G5 计算机方向专业,USACO 竞赛堪称申请 “大杀器”——MIT 录取者中 32% 曾拿下其白金级奖项,认可度拉满。USACO计算机竞赛2025-2026 赛季 12 月开赛,分铜到铂金四级参赛,满分可直接晋级,更有金 / 铂金级认证时间、禁 AI 等新规需注意。今天就讲讲新赛季如何备赛。
USACO(美国计算机奥林匹克竞赛,United States of America Computing Olympiad)是全球最具影响力的中学生计算机编程竞赛之一,由美国官方主办,旨在选拔和培养顶尖算法人才。竞赛面向全球学生开放,无论国籍和年龄,均可免费注册参与。
✅适合人群:零基础或刚接触编程的学生。
✅考试形式:3 道题,满分 1000 分,限时 4 小时。
✅考核内容:
基础语法:变量、循环、条件语句、函数等。
暴力枚举与模拟:通过直接遍历所有可能情况解决问题,
简单逻辑思维:如排序、基础数学计算。
🥉晋级机制:通常得分≥700 分即可晋级白银组,首次参赛选手默认从青铜组开始。
✅适合人群:掌握基础编程,希望学习基础算法的学生。
搜索算法:广度优先搜索和深度优先搜索。
贪心算法:在每一步选择最优策略,如区间调度问题。
二分查找:通过不断缩小范围提高效率,例如查找数组中的特定值。
数据结构:栈、队列、数组的应用。
🥈晋级机制:通常得分≥700 分即可晋级黄金组。
✅适合人群:具备扎实算法基础,希望挑战复杂问题的学生。
动态规划:将问题分解为子问题,如背包问题变种。
图论:最短路径、最小生成树。
高级数据结构:线段树、并查集优化,例如处理连通性问题。
数学建模:数论、组合数学在算法中的应用,如中国剩余定理。
🥇晋级机制:必须在美东时间周六 12:00-12:15 的特定窗口参赛,得分≥700 分且成绩认证后晋级铂金组。
✅适合人群:全球顶尖算法选手,需具备问题建模与算法设计能力。
高级图论:网络流、强连通分量分解。
计算几何:多边形面积、点线关系,例如判断凸包。
高级数据结构:平衡树、后缀数组,用于高效处理字符串问题。
数学优化:启发式搜索、线性代数应用。
🏅晋级机制:需在认证窗口内参赛并达到分数线,全球晋级率仅 2%-3%。
🎯备赛流程:掌握编程语言,练基础逻辑,刷真题
✅编程语言:首选C++。C++运行效率高,在竞赛中优势明显,且绝大多数顶级选手都在使用。Java和Python也可用,但Python在执行效率上可能成为瓶颈。
🌟学习内容:
基础语法:变量、数据类型、输入输出。
控制流:if-else 条件判断、for/while 循环、嵌套循环。
简单函数:自定义函数。
基础数据结构:数组、列表、字符串处理。
🎯备赛流程:补基础算法、练代码效率、刷真题
BFS/DFS(搜索):BFS 求最短路径、DFS 遍历
贪心算法:区间调度、哈夫曼编码、找零问题
二分查找:有序数组查找、二分答案
栈 / 队列:栈的 LIFO、队列的 FIFO
🎯备赛流程:攻克高级算法、练综合建模、
动态规划(DP):线性 DP、背包 DP、区间 DP
图论:Dijkstra、Kruskal/Prim、拓扑排序
并查集:路径压缩、按秩合并、带权并查集
线段树:区间查询、区间更新
数论:质数筛、最大公约数、同余定理
🎯备赛流程:攻克顶级算法、练创新建模
高级图论:网络流、强连通分量 SCC、双连通分量
计算几何:点线关系、凸包、多边形面积
高级数据结构:平衡树、后缀数组、树状数组进阶
数学优化:线性代数、模拟退火、容斥原理
关键字:USACO考试,USACO培训班,USACO辅导机构,